Elevating NAD Quantities: Investigating Benefits, Sources & Supplementation
Supporting healthy NAD quantities is increasingly recognized as crucial for overall vitality. This vital coenzyme plays a critical part in cellular bioenergetics, DNA repair, and processes. As we age, NAD+ concentrations naturally decline, contributing to age-related conditions and lessened potential for renewal. Fortunately, several methods exist to improve Nicotinamide Adenine Dinucleotide amounts. These encompass obtaining building blocks from nutrition like poultry and leafy green vegetables, as well as considering Nicotinamide Adenine Dinucleotide boosting supplementation. While studies are ongoing, molecules including nicotinamide riboside (NR) and nicotinamide mononucleotide (NMN) have shown promise in preclinical trials and some early human studies. Ultimately, a comprehensive approach that combines a balanced intake with judicious supplementation, where indicated and under medical guidance, may be helpful for maintaining optimal NAD+ levels.
